Alchemist, the acclaimed coffee brand from Singapore, has made its highly anticipated debut in Japan with the grand opening of two new locations in Tokyo. This marked the brand’s first international expansion outside Singapore. The Tokyo stores, located in the vibrant neighbourhoods of Aoyama and Asakusa, opened their doors to the public in late June 2025. By Cath Isabedra The future of protein is no longer theoretical—it's being cultivated in bioreactors, advanced in regulatory roundtables, and tasted in regional food tech hubs. But in Asia, the road to commercial viability for cultivated meat and seafood hinges on one essential pillar: food safety. While innovation continues in biomanufacturing and novel protein development, regulatory readiness and public trust remain the deciding factors for long-term success. Tecnologico de Monterrey promotes sustainable agriculture with nanobiotechnology
Guadalajara, Jalisco, Mexico. July 2025.– Researchers at Tecnologico de Monterrey are leading a pioneering project in the country that explores the potential of nanobiotechnology to improve the natural processes of nutrition, immunity, and development in plants, marking an important step toward more sustainable and resilient agriculture in Mexico.
